Transaction 64a580097956c4df740cf8d95219142bc5e873087cd0c49cb2f122b72ba93bf3
2 Input
2 Outputs
- 64a580097956c4df740cf8d95219142bc5e873087cd0c49cb2f122b72ba93bf3:0
- 64a580097956c4df740cf8d95219142bc5e873087cd0c49cb2f122b72ba93bf3:1
value 10477701
address 1HmEWf7M3Z52aWQReUbB53GdWiK8FPeAZn
value 149830
address 1FgfVRAv8dF3fQ8HRrGxbRWoaY18C2kBh7